Hrithik Roshan and Sussanne Khan

Reportedly, Hrithik had to pay Rs. 380 crores as alimony to Sussanne Khan post their divorce in 2012.

 

Karisma Kapoor and Sunjay Kapur

Karisma Kapoor and Sunjay Kapoor split in 2016 after 11 years of marriage. As divorce settlement, Sunjay had to purchase bonds worth Rs.14 crores for upbringing and care of their two children. This will attract interest worth Rs.10 lakhs per month.

 

Farhan Akhtar and Adhuna Bhabani

Farhan and Adhuna got divorced in 2017. Their marriage lasted 16 years before they decided to part ways. After the divorce, Adhuna expressed her desire to keep their Mumbai residence (a sprawling 10,000 square feet bungalow in Bandstand) for herself. Alongside this, Farhan is also contributing a major amount in the security and upbringing of their daughters.

 

Saif Ali Khan and Amrita Singh

The Nawab of Pataudi reportedly made a statement saying, “I’m supposed to give Amrita Rs. 5 crores, out of which I’ve already given her 2.5 crores. I’m also paying her Rs. 1 lakh per month to take care of my son till he turns 18.”

 

Sanjay Dutt and Rhea Pillai

Rhea got a sea facing luxury apartment along with an expensive car as alimony from Sanjay Dutt after their divorce. It is said that he even took care of her bills for a long time.

 

Aditya Chopra and Payal Khanna

Rani and Aditya had to pay a huge price for tying the knot. Aditya’s first wife Payal Khanna was given a hefty sum of 50 crores as alimony.

 

Aamir Khan and Reena Dutta

 

Aamir had to reportedly pay alimony of Rs. 50 crores to his first wife Reena at the time of their divorce.

 

Prabhu Deva and Ramlath

Prabhu Deva had to pay a one-time alimony amount of Rs. 1 lakh along with two expensive cars and property of approximately Rs. 25 crores.

 

Arbaaz Khan and Malaika Arora

 

Though it was never confirmed by any source or by Arbaaz and Malaika themselves, it is said that Malaika demanded an alimony of Rs. 10-15 crores from Arbaaz post their divorce. Whether this was granted by the court or provided by Arbaaz is unconfirmed.
